Constant Hives, Taking Zantac, Allegra, No Relief. Next Step ?
My son has had hives for over 6 months. He sees an allergist/ rheumatologist who has him taking Zantac twice a day and Allegra in AM and Zyrtec in PM. He has also had merdrol dose packs off and on. They work for awhile and then stop working. He has had lad work which was negative. He is due to have another ANA lab test. He does have psoriasis and is allergic to Bactrim and seafood.He also has not been using any NSAIDS. What is next step?? He is miserable>
